Speed vs. Accuracy: The Jugglers’ Act

Take the moment a penalty is awarded. The odds adjust, the market deepens, and the betting engine must recompute every linked market in under a second. That’s the same frenetic tempo you feel when Gonzo’s Quest drops a multiplier – the heart lurches, the stomach drops, and you’re forced to decide whether to lock in or chase a bigger payout.

Because the algorithm behind a live score bet casino isn’t a mystical oracle; it’s a cold, deterministic code that parses streams of data faster than a human could. It doesn’t care about your hopes, your gut feelings, or that you’ve been chanting “win big” since the morning commute. It simply recalculates, re‑prices, and re‑offers, often before you’ve even registered the previous change.

And that’s where the rubber meets the road. The seasoned gambler knows that the only reliable tool in this high‑velocity arena is a well‑honed spreadsheet of implied probabilities, not a flashy “VIP” badge promising exclusive odds. Practical Playbook for the Live‑Betting Veteran

  • Set strict time‑delay thresholds. If an odds shift occurs in under 400 ms, consider it noise.
  • Use a secondary screen to monitor the live feed while keeping the betting window open on the primary monitor.
  • Apply a hedging rule: never risk more than 2% of your bankroll on any single live market.
  • Ignore the “free spin” offers that pop up during halftime – they’re bait, not a boon.
  • Record each wager with its exact timestamp; patterns emerge only with meticulous data.

But the list isn’t a gospel. It’s a reminder that every tactic has its limits, especially when the bookmaker’s software throttles your request queue. The last thing you want is to stare at a loading icon while the match enters extra time, only to watch the market close on you like a shop door at 9 pm.
